4IOU
Crystal structure of the HIV-1 Vif binding, catalytically active domain of APOBEC3F
Summary for 4IOU
Entry DOI | 10.2210/pdb4iou/pdb |
Descriptor | DNA dC->dU-editing enzyme APOBEC-3F, ZINC ION (3 entities in total) |
Functional Keywords | catalytic domain, cytidine deaminase, cytidine deaminase-like, hydrolase, dna binding, cytidine deamination |
Biological source | Homo sapiens (human) |
Total number of polymer chains | 4 |
Total formula weight | 93109.38 |
Authors | Bohn, M.,Shandilya, S.M.D.,Schiffer, C.A. (deposition date: 2013-01-08, release date: 2013-05-29, Last modification date: 2023-09-20) |
Primary citation | Bohn, M.F.,Shandilya, S.M.,Albin, J.S.,Kouno, T.,Anderson, B.D.,McDougle, R.M.,Carpenter, M.A.,Rathore, A.,Evans, L.,Davis, A.N.,Zhang, J.,Lu, Y.,Somasundaran, M.,Matsuo, H.,Harris, R.S.,Schiffer, C.A. Crystal Structure of the DNA Cytosine Deaminase APOBEC3F: The Catalytically Active and HIV-1 Vif-Binding Domain. Structure, 21:1042-1050, 2013 Cited by PubMed: 23685212DOI: 10.1016/j.str.2013.04.010 PDB entries with the same primary citation |
Experimental method | X-RAY DIFFRACTION (2.751 Å) |
